Today! Wednesday, July 27th

LAST STORY TIMES FOR SUMMER READING

10 a.m. or 1 p.m. or 3 p.m. at Fulda Memorial Library

This is the last week of summer reading story times on Wednesdays. This Wednesday, staff from the Fulda Avera Clinic will hold a teddy bear clinic for the preschool and kindergartners (10 a.m.) and the 1st, 2nd, 3rd graders (1 p.m.).  Kids can bring their own plush animal for a check-up, or the library has plenty of stuffed animals for kids to choose from. During the 3 p.m. story time (for 4th, 5th, 6th graders), kids will get to chat with the staff and ask questions.

This is also the final week to vote in the Battle of the Funny Books! From a pool of 8 hilarious picture books, kids and adults have narrowed down to 2 finalists: “The Book with No Pictures” by B.J. Novak versus “Dragons Love Tacos” by Adam Rubin. Both books are read during story time and voting is open until next Wednesday, August 3rd. The winning book will be announced at the Hula Hoop dance workshop on Thursday, August 4th.
